Anchor Brewing Shuts Down After 127 Years

2023-07-13 4 Dailymotion

Anchor Brewing Shuts Down , After 127 Years.<br />The oldest craft brewery in America is going out of business after experiencing "a combination of challenging economic factors and declining sales since 2016," Insider reports. .<br />The oldest craft brewery in America is going out of business after experiencing "a combination of challenging economic factors and declining sales since 2016," Insider reports. .<br />The company made the announcement on July 12.<br />Unfortunately, today's economic pressures have made the business no longer sustainable, and we had to make the heartbreaking decision to cease operations, Anchor Brewing, via statement.<br />Anchor was acquired by Sapporo in 2017.<br />An anonymous employee claims that <br />"upper management ran this company not understanding how craft brewing works in America.".<br />Sapporo has made rookie mistakes left and right, they have destroyed what this brand was, Anonymous employee, via Insider.<br />With the exception of 2021, production declined each year since 2017.<br />Over the past year, Sapporo has unsuccessfully attempted to sell the brewing company.<br />According to Anchor, it is "possible that a buyer will step forward for the brewery as part of the liquidation process.".<br />Currently, the brewery is no longer producing beer. Its stock will be phased out by the end of July.<br />61 people were employed by the brewery. .<br />61 people were employed by the brewery.
